If you're driving from Dublin (on Ireland's east coast) to Dingle (on Ireland's west coast),
thebesttwostopstobreakthelongjourneyacrosstheIrishinteriorareKilkenny,Ireland's
finest medieval town; and the Rock of Cashel, a thought-provoking early Christian site
crowning the Plain of Tipperary.
Counties Kilkenny and Tipperary (“Tipp” to locals) are blood rivals on the hurling
field, with the lion's share of the GAA national championships split between them. Watch
for sporting lads carrying their hurlies (ash-wood sticks with broad, flat ends) to or from
school. These two counties also boast some of the finest agricultural land on this rocky and
boggy island. Farm tractors rumble the back roads when it's not a long way to Tipperary.
